I was a tech and mobility supervisor, and a Copy and Print Supervisor at a store in Indiana. I worked for 5 years before I moved away, and when I moved back I went right back to work at the same Staples store. In the 1 year I was there, I realized this company had changed soo much for the worse. We started with 3 managers in the store, plus keyholders. Within a year we where down to only being able to have 1 Store Manager, plus the keyholders/"team supervisors". That combined with the announcement of closing stores, firing our district manager and merging us into Clevelands district, and losing prime tech even though we where hitting the goals. I knew it was time to just get out. So I did just that and I left. Didn't even put in 2 weeks. I hope everything works out for you. The grass in greener on the other side!!
